Transaction 97c58796a81377df7891ca195f9524e9ed8189a198e2aa9fa586bb2d3de92757
1 Input
1 Output
-
97c58796a81377df7891ca195f9524e9ed8189a198e2aa9fa586bb2d3de92757:0
- value
- 788879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8314ec969f48bbda4290c3d3fc0bee41bd17151 OP_EQUAL
- address
- 3JUwKoaMURNq2ZRyhWqkDWjcqfLHYVYQx6